Important Terms in Car Accident Legal Cases

Understanding common legal terms can help you better navigate your car accident claim. Below are definitions of key concepts frequently encountered during the process.

Negligence

Negligence refers to a failure to exercise reasonable care, resulting in harm to another person. In car accident cases, negligence is often the basis for establishing liability when a driver’s careless actions cause a collision.

Damages

Damages refer to the monetary compensation sought for losses resulting from an accident, including medical expenses, lost wages, property damage, and pain and suffering.

Liability

Liability is the legal responsibility for damages caused by one’s actions or omissions. Determining liability is crucial in car accident claims to identify which party must compensate the injured individual.

Settlement

A settlement is an agreement reached between parties to resolve a claim without going to trial. Settlements often involve compensation paid by the liable party or their insurer to the injured person.

Tips for Handling Your Car Accident Case

Document Everything Thoroughly

After an accident, collect as much information as possible, including photos, witness details, and police reports. Keeping detailed records helps build a strong case and supports your claim for damages.

Seek Medical Attention Promptly

Even if injuries seem minor, get a medical evaluation immediately. Early treatment documents your condition and can be critical in demonstrating the extent of injuries related to the accident.

Avoid Early Settlement Offers

Insurance companies may propose quick settlements that do not fully cover your losses. Consult with a legal professional before accepting any offers to ensure your rights are protected.

In California, the statute of limitations for filing a personal injury claim related to a car accident is generally two years from the date of the accident. It is important to act promptly to gather evidence and file your claim within this timeframe. Missing the deadline can result in losing your right to seek compensation, so consulting with a legal professional early is advisable to ensure timely action.
